Man with mental illness dies after running amok in Penang

GEORGE TOWN: A man who suffered from mental illness has died after running amok at his family home in Taman Desa Baru, Gelugor here.

North-east OCPD Asst Comm Abdul Rozak Muhammad said they received a report from the man's sister at 3.58am on Friday (Sept 12), who said her younger brother had gone on a rampage and requested police assistance.

"When police arrived at the scene, they found a 48-year-old man lying unconscious face down in the kitchen. Personnel from Penang Hospital at the location confirmed his death.

"Investigations revealed that the man, who had a history of mental illness, went on a rampage at home and threatened family members," he said in a statement on Friday.

He said the man collapsed and lost consciousness during the incident.

Abdul Rozak said a post-mortem examination conducted found fluid in the lungs as the cause of death, while police investigations found no elements of foul play.

The case has been classified as sudden death. – Bernama
